According to BlackRock's recently released weekly market commentary, the investment landscape is being shaped by stubborn inflation readings and evolving monetary policy expectations. The commentary points out that recent economic data, including strong payroll numbers and elevated services inflation, have delayed market expectations for the first Fed rate cut. BlackRock strategists suggest that a "higher for longer" interest rate environment is likely to persist until there is clearer evidence of sustained disinflation. They observe that bond yields, particularly on longer-dated Treasuries, have moved higher as markets digest the possibility of a delayed easing cycle. In equity markets, the commentary notes a rotation away from rate-sensitive sectors toward areas that may benefit from sustained economic growth, such as industrials and select technology. BlackRock emphasizes the importance of focusing on quality and durability of earnings in this environment, cautioning that broad market rallies may be unsustainable without a clearer rate outlook. Key takeaways from the commentary include the view that inflation may remain above the Federal Reserve's 2% target for an extended period, potentially limiting the scope for rate cuts in the near term. BlackRock's analysis suggests that market volatility could persist as investors adjust to this new policy trajectory. The firm highlights a divergence between current market pricing and the Fed's own projections, noting that this gap may need to narrow before markets stabilize. On the sector front, BlackRock recommends an overweight to healthcare and technology, citing structural growth trends like digital transformation and demographic shifts, while being underweight on real estate and utilities due to interest rate sensitivity. The commentary also cautions that geopolitical risks, including trade policy changes and regional conflicts, could add to market uncertainty and affect risk premiums. From an investment perspective, BlackRock's commentary implies that a tactical approach may be warranted given the uncertain macroeconomic backdrop. The firm suggests that investors might consider focusing on bonds with shorter durations to reduce interest rate risk, while also seeking opportunities in quality equities with strong balance sheets and consistent cash flows. The broader perspective from BlackRock indicates that while the economy remains resilient, the pace of disinflation may be slower than anticipated, which could keep central banks cautious globally. The commentary underscores the need for diversified portfolios that can weather potential shifts in the growth-inflation mix, and it recommends an active management stance to navigate sector rotations. Ultimately, BlackRock's view suggests that patience and discipline could be key as markets await clearer signals from economic data and central bank communications.
